dc.descriptionGiven a generically smooth stable curve over a discrete valuation ring such that its special fibre is irreducible with one double point, we construct a moduli stack over that descrete valuation ring which is a model for the moduli stack of vector bundles over the generic fibre of the curve. The model has the following nice properties: 1. It is regular. 2. Its special fibre is a normal crossing divisor. 3. The normalization of its special fibre is a locally trivial KGl-bundle over the moduli stack of vector bundles over the normalization of the special fibre of the curve. Here KGl is a canonical compactification of the general linear group. Our motivation is that such a model may help to give recursion formulae for such cohomological invariants of the moduli stack of vector bundles on smooth curves which depend only on the genus of the curve.
